IPv4 info : 146.251.144.149

rDNS
IP Address 146.251.144.149    (2465960085)
IP Range 146.251.0.0/16
Country Name Saudi Arabia sa
Region Name Makkah al Mukarramah
City Name Mecca
Latitude/Longitude 21.42667,39.826111
IDD Code 966
Time Zone +03:00
ZIP Code -
Currency Saudi Riyal(SAR)
Main Language Arabic
Weather Station Code SAXX0013
Weather Station Name Mecca
Carrier ASN Bayanat Al-Oula for Network Services Limited Co. - AS35819
ISP Name

IP Map